#af9de5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af9de5 is composed of 68.6% red, 61.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 75.7%. #af9de5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5f3bcb.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#af9de5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af9de5 has RGB values of R:175, G:157,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 11509221.

Shades and Tints of #af9de5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05030b is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#af9de5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0bec4 is the less saturated color, while #a385fd is the most saturated one.
